BACKGROUND OF THE INVENTION
1. Field of the Invention
The present invention relates to a method of recycling organic waste, and more particularly to a method of recycling organic wastes in which a pro-ferment, that is produced by mixing a medium with an organic waste, are mixed with other organic wastes such as feces and urine of domestic animals, pruned branches, bush, and lawn, and which accelerates the fermentation of the latter organic waste to obtain compost.
2. Description of the Related Art
Most of the organic waste such as garbage from households, restaurants and the like is burnt or disposed of in a conventional way at reclaimed lands or the like.
However, with conventional methods, problems such as dioxin pollution from garbage furnace and the leakage of harmful materials or matter contained in organic wastes at reclaimed lands remain unsolved. In addition, the capacity of final places for disposal is limited.
In consideration of the above-mentioned problems, in recent years, organic wastes have been ground and dried to be utilized as compost, but the recycling ratio of the wastes is still low.
By the way, Japanese stockbreeding output has been decreasing due to the shortage of successors, the increase in imported meat, environmental problems such as an offensive odor emitted from stockbreeders, and so on. Therefore, it is generally said that a large-scale management for the future is indispensable to realizing favorable managing conditions.
One of the problems for the large-scale management is the disposal of the feces and urine of domestic animals. Generally, the feces and urine of dairy cows are high in a water content, and low in a nitrogen content, which makes the fermentation of the feces and urine difficult, and it takes about one year to finish the fermentation when the feces and urine are merely left as they are. Even machinery is used, it is necessary to accelerate the fermentation for approximately one and half months after decreasing water content of the feces and urine before using the machinery for two to three months in summer or for more than one month in winter. Therefore, the feces and urine of dairy cows are mostly disposed of at farms as raw, causing environmental problems such as an offensive odor and pollution of rivers throughout the country.
To solve the above-mentioned problems, Japanese government and local municipalities have subsidized stockbreeders to facilitate the construction of compost manufacturing facilities, and there have been some cases in which local municipalities have constructed compost manufacturing facilities to handle the feces and urine of domestic animals generated in their territories by themselves.
Furthermore, organic wastes such as pruned branches, bush, and lawn, which are generated mainly at parks, river terraces, roads, households, and golf courses also have been burnt in a conventional way. However, the capacity of burning facilities is also limited, or maybe the disposal of such organic wastes are very cumbersome or difficult, which is what local municipalities are anxious about.
In addition to the above countermeasures, they have tried to ferment the organic wastes and utilized them as compost. However, whether the fermentation is preferably carried out or not often depends on the climate, kinds and properties of pruned branches, bush, and lawn. Especially when the pruned branches have many trunks and stumps, the nitrogen content of the pruned branches becomes low, which makes the fermentation of the branches difficult. Therefore, no effective disposing measures have been found so far.
SUMMARY OF THE INVENTION
The objective of the present invention is to provide a method of recycling organic wastes in which organic wastes such as garbage from households, restaurants are recycled and utilized as a pro-ferment for other organic wastes such as feces and urine of domestic animals, pruned branches, bush, and lawn, that are generated at parks, river terraces, roads, and the like to utilize them as compost.
To accomplish the above objective, in a method of recycling organic wastes according to the present invention, a pro-ferment, which is obtained by mixing a medium with organic wastes, are mixed with other organic wastes to accelerate the fermentation of the latter organic waste and to produce compost.
With the above method according to the present invention, not only is it unnecessary to neither burn nor dispose of both the former and latter organic wastes, but also compost for agricultural products can be obtained from the organic wastes.
In the above method according to the present invention, the medium may be composed of dried coffee refuse, one of wheat bran and coconut fiber, which are easily obtainable, and ferment bacillus.
Furthermore, in the above method, the latter organic wastes can be the feces and urine of domestic animals such as dairy cows. In case of the feces and urine of dairy cows, 0.4 to 0.6 ton of the pro-ferment is preferably mixed with one ton of the feces and urine to obtain optimum water content of the feces and urine for the fermentation thereof. And, in case of the feces of dairy cows, 0.3 to 0.5 ton of the pro-ferment is preferably mixed with one ton of the feces to obtain optimum water content thereof.
With this method, it is unnecessary to burn and dispose of organic wastes, and nor is there also need to feed the feces and urine of domestic animals as they are. Furthermore, compost is obtained from the feces and urine, which can be utilized for agricultural productions.
Furthermore, in the above method, the latter organic waste can be one of the pruned branches, bush, lawn, and mixture of these materials, which allows the former and the latter organic waste such as pruned branches not to be burnt and disposed of. In addition, compost is obtained from the pruned branches and so on.
